Greek Yogurt Brownies

Greek Yogurt Brownies are a healthier twist on classic brownies—lower in fat, calories, and carbs! These fudgy, one-bowl brownies are so delicious, you won’t even notice the yogurt!

Ingredients:

  • ½ cup chopped chocolate
  • 1 cup vanilla yogurt (see notes)
  • ½ cup sugar (white, brown, or sugar-free)
  • ¾ cup all-purpose flour (gluten-free, if needed)
  • ½ cup cocoa powder
  • ½ teaspoon baking soda
  • ½ cup milk of choice (I used unsweetened almond milk)
  • 1 cup chocolate chips (optional)

Instructions:

  1. Preheat the oven to 180°C/350°F. Line an 8×8-inch pan with parchment paper.
  2. In a microwave-safe bowl, melt the chopped chocolate. Let it cool for 1-2 minutes before whisking in the yogurt and sugar until smooth. Transfer to a large mixing bowl.
  3. Add the flour, cocoa powder, and baking soda to the chocolate mixture. Mix until just combined. Stir in the milk and mix well. Fold in chocolate chips if using.
  4.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and bake for 25-30 minutes, or until a skewer inserted comes out clean. Let the brownies c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Enjoy these guilt-free, fudgy brownies!
